ai-credits-mcp

MCP server that exposes AI credit usage data from OpenMeter to the TAIS AI chat service. Queries are automatically scoped to the calling tenant and restricted to admin users.


Tools

All tools require the caller to be in the Administrators group. Each tool returns a markdown table (for the LLM to summarise) and a [Download Excel](url) link pointing to a temporary .xlsx file served at /download/<token>. The link expires after 10 minutes. They are automatically scoped to the calling user's tenant — no tenant parameter is exposed.

If the request exceeds 50 rows in the text preview, the table is truncated with a note to see the Excel file for the full dataset.

How the AI decides which tool to call

When you ask about credit usage in the AI chat, the model picks the appropriate tool automatically:

  • Totals / "how much overall" → get_credit_usage_by_tenant

  • Breakdowns by user / module / skill → get_credit_usage_summary

  • Individual events / audit trail → get_credit_events

If no date range is specified, the last 7 days are used by default. To change the range, phrase your question naturally: "...for January 2026" or "...since last month" — the model will translate this to ISO 8601 parameters.

Security

Invariant

Enforcement

Admin-only access

X-User-UserRole checked on every call; accepted values: admin, Administrators

Tenant-scoped

X-Tenant-Name header used as filter; callers cannot override it

Tenant header absent

Returns an error — no data is exposed

OPENMETER_API_KEY never exposed

Only used inside query_credits._get(); never returned to callers

The TAIS chatbot-agent-service forwards both headers automatically on every MCP connection.

AI chat integration

Use the registration script to register the tool and wire it to a TAIS session:

bash scripts/register.sh

The script reads TAIS_JWT from .env, decodes the tenant and user automatically, registers the tool against the local TAIS API, and PATCHes the session. If TAIS_SESSION_ID is not set in .env it will prompt you interactively.

Note: registered tools expire after ~1 hour. Re-run the script when the tool stops responding.
